Executive Communications Advisor

Lincolnshire, Illinois, United States March 20, 2026 Eightfold Ai Talent Intelligence Platform
Leads development of communications platform for one or more of our Executive leaders that includes creating associated communications for them to engage with their respective audiences and drive employee engagement and business understanding. Deliverables include All Hands meetings, email, video, presentations, and other communications medium as needed to raise awareness of key corporate topics Provides counsel to leaders on effective employee communications - both written and verbal to help them more effectively deliver compelling messages through communications vehicles Partners with cross-functional teams to deliver strategic communications within a complex and matrixed organization Builds creative assets to support Executive Communications efforts - infographics, PowerPoint presentations, etc. Performs other duties associated with strategic communications for special projects as assigned by the Executive level team Supports the coordination, content development, theme and logistics for communications and events and finds ways to improve and increase overall employee engagement Sets clear goals and objectives and assess the effectiveness of employee communications. Measures ROI on communications initiatives activities to help prioritize resources for maximum impact Has a strong perspective on organizational culture and recommend initiatives for influencing and managing change Works closely with the Corporate/Business Communication, IT Communication, and Information Security Communication teams to ensure Zebra communications best practices and processes are followed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Communications, Public Relations or similar, graduate degree preferred 8+ years of experience, preferably with B2B, technology or channel experience. Agency experience a plus. Travel up to 10% Excellent corporate storyteller who has the desire and ability to understand business and develop strategies that bring it alive and help different stakeholders understand how they fit Internal communications experience highly preferred Demonstrated commitment to quality and detail. Organized and personable with strong written and oral communication skills Proven ability to work with different stakeholders and teams in a global organization while balancing multiple priorities and meeting deadlines in a fast-paced business environment. Strong interpersonal skills and business acumen Results-oriented, with a discipline of measurement around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) Solid project management skills are a must, including the ability to manage multiple projects and a dynamic work environment Proficiency in using a range of technology tools (such as email platforms, SharePoint, Smartsheet, PowerPoint and Canva) to support communication activities across the organization Experience working in video production, presentation development, and social media a plus

How to Get Hired at Zebra Technologies

  • Zebra Technologies is a $4-5B enterprise hardware and software company that powers front-line workers in retail, warehouse, healthcare, manufacturing, and logistics — far larger and more strategic than its consumer profile suggests.
  • The 2014 Motorola Solutions Enterprise acquisition reshaped the company; the 2020 Reflexis (now Workcloud), 2022 Matrox Imaging, 2023 Adaptive Vision, and Photoneo deals are reshaping it again toward software and machine vision.
